The Workplace of the Future: Employment & Privacy Considerations Post Covid-19

Walters People are joined by an expert panel from William Fry including Catherine O’Flynn, Leo Moore and Nuala Clayton to discuss how employers can best prepare its “Workplace of the Future” in light of Covid-19.

The panellists outline the Return to Work Safety Protocol publication, key data protection issues as well as employment law issues predicted to arise as employees re-enter the workplace.

Topics of discussion: 

  • How can an employer best prepare its "workplace of the future" in light of COVID-19?
  • What are the key health and safety law considerations arising from the publication of the Return to Work Safely Protocol?
  • As employees begin coming back to the workplace, what issues might arise from an employment law perspective?
  • What should an employer consider if employees remain working from home?
  • What are the key data protection issues for an employer associated with re-opening workplaces and/or the continuation of home working?
